SAVANNAH, Ga. (WTOC) - A warrant has been taken out against a Savannah woman for Fraud and Forgery.
Georgia Insurance and Safety Fire Commissioner John King announced Friday that a warrant has been issued for the arrest of 49-year-old Helen S. Coco for one count of Insurance Fraud and one count of Forgery in the 1st Degree.
